in Marlas school 6/15 of the students do not ride the bus to school. of these students 5/9 walk to school. what fraction of the
Debora [2.8K]

Answer:

The fraction of the students that walk in in Marla's school  is equal to \frac{2}{9}

Step-by-step explanation:

Let

x------> the total students in Marla's school

we know that

The number of students that not ride the bus is equal to

\frac{6}{15}x\ students

The number of students that walk to the school is equal to

\frac{6}{15}x*\frac{5}{9}=\frac{2}{9}x\ students

therefore

The fraction of the students that walk in in Marla's school  is equal to \frac{2}{9}
